Event narrative
A social media post showed a landslide along PR-123 at km 28.5 in Adjuntas that sent rocks and debris onto the road, causing a partial closure. The event was attributed to heavy showers in recent days in the mountainous region.
Wider weather episode
Heavy shower and thunderstorm activity was observed each afternoon along the interior and western Puerto Rico. These rains saturated soils, causing a few landslides by the middle of the month.
